Tải và chuyển đổi tệp OTG bằng GroupDocs.Conversion cho .NET: Hướng dẫn dành cho nhà phát triển

Giới thiệu

Bạn có muốn mở và thao tác các tệp OpenDocument Graphics Template (OTG) trong các ứng dụng .NET của mình không? Nhiều nhà phát triển phải đối mặt với thách thức này, đặc biệt là khi xử lý các tác vụ chuyển đổi tài liệu. Hãy sử dụng GroupDocs.Conversion for .NET—một thư viện mạnh mẽ giúp đơn giản hóa việc tải và chuyển đổi các tệp OTG một cách liền mạch.

Trong hướng dẫn này, chúng tôi sẽ trình bày cách sử dụng GroupDocs.Conversion để tải tệp OTG hiệu quả vào ứng dụng .NET của bạn, đáp ứng nhu cầu của các nhà phát triển muốn nâng cao khả năng quản lý tài liệu.

Những gì bạn sẽ học được:

  • Cài đặt và thiết lập GroupDocs.Conversion cho .NET
  • Các bước để tải tệp OTG bằng GroupDocs.Conversion
  • Cấu hình chính và cân nhắc về hiệu suất
  • Ứng dụng thực tế với các nền tảng .NET khác

Chúng ta hãy bắt đầu bằng cách xem lại các điều kiện tiên quyết cần thiết cho hướng dẫn này.

Điều kiện tiên quyết

Để thực hiện hướng dẫn này một cách hiệu quả, hãy đảm bảo bạn có:

  • Môi trường phát triển .NET: Nên sử dụng Visual Studio (phiên bản 2019 trở lên) vì dễ sử dụng.
  • GroupDocs.Conversion cho thư viện .NET phiên bản 25.3.0 được cài đặt thông qua NuGet Package Manager Console hoặc .NET CLI.
  • Hiểu biết cơ bản về C# và quen thuộc với các khái niệm xử lý tài liệu.

Bây giờ, chúng ta hãy tiến hành thiết lập GroupDocs.Conversion trong dự án của bạn.

Thiết lập GroupDocs.Conversion cho .NET

Đầu tiên, hãy cài đặt gói GroupDocs.Conversion bằng NuGet Package Manager Console hoặc .NET CLI:

Bảng điều khiển quản lý gói NuGet:

Install-Package GroupDocs.Conversion -Version 25.3.0

.NETCLI:

dotnet add package GroupDocs.Conversion --version 25.3.0

Mua lại giấy phép

GroupDocs.Conversion cung cấp bản dùng thử miễn phí để khám phá khả năng của nó. Để sử dụng lâu dài, hãy cân nhắc việc mua giấy phép tạm thời hoặc mua phiên bản đầy đủ:

Khởi tạo cơ bản

Sau khi cài đặt và cấp phép, hãy khởi tạo GroupDocs.Conversion trong ứng dụng của bạn. Sau đây là một thiết lập đơn giản:

using System;
using GroupDocs.Conversion;

public class LoadOtgFileExample
{
    public static void Run()
    {
        // Xác định đường dẫn đến tệp OTG của bạn.
        string documentPath = "YOUR_DOCUMENT_DIRECTORY/sample.otg";

        // Tải tệp OTG nguồn bằng GroupDocs.Conversion.Converter.
        using (var converter = new Converter(documentPath))
        {
            Console.WriteLine("OTG file loaded successfully.");
        }
    }
}

Trong ví dụ này, thay thế YOUR_DOCUMENT_DIRECTORY/sample.otg với đường dẫn thực tế đến tệp OTG của bạn.

Hướng dẫn thực hiện

Tải tính năng tệp OTG

Tính năng này trình bày cách tải hiệu quả Mẫu đồ họa OpenDocument (OTG) bằng GroupDocs.Conversion cho .NET. Thực hiện theo các bước sau:

Bước 1: Xác định đường dẫn tài liệu

Bắt đầu bằng cách chỉ định đường dẫn đến tệp OTG của bạn trong một biến chuỗi. Điều này thông báo Converter đối tượng nơi để định vị tài liệu của bạn:

string documentPath = "YOUR_DOCUMENT_DIRECTORY/sample.otg";

Bước 2: Khởi tạo đối tượng chuyển đổi

Tạo một phiên bản của Converter lớp, truyền đường dẫn của tệp OTG của bạn đến hàm tạo của nó. Điều này tải tài liệu của bạn vào bộ nhớ để xử lý thêm:

using (var converter = new Converter(documentPath))
{
    // Đối tượng chuyển đổi hiện đã được khởi tạo và tải bằng tệp OTG.
}

Bước 3: Thực hiện các thao tác

Với converter đối tượng được thiết lập, bạn có thể thực hiện nhiều thao tác khác nhau như chuyển đổi tài liệu sang các định dạng khác nhau hoặc trích xuất dữ liệu. Ví dụ này xác nhận rằng tệp đã được tải:

Console.WriteLine("OTG file loaded successfully.");

Mẹo khắc phục sự cố

  • Lỗi đường dẫn tệp: Đảm bảo đường dẫn tệp của bạn chính xác và ứng dụng của bạn có thể truy cập được.
  • Khả năng tương thích của thư viện: Xác minh rằng bạn đã cài đặt phiên bản GroupDocs.Conversion tương thích.

Ứng dụng thực tế

Sử dụng GroupDocs.Conversion để tải các tệp OTG mở ra nhiều khả năng:

  1. Chuyển đổi tài liệu tự động: Chuyển đổi dễ dàng các tệp OTG sang định dạng PDF, Word hoặc hình ảnh trong các ứng dụng .NET của bạn.
  2. Tạo bản xem trước tài liệu: Triển khai tính năng xem trước trong hệ thống quản lý tài liệu bằng cách chuyển đổi các trang sang định dạng hình ảnh.
  3. Tích hợp với Ứng dụng Web: Sử dụng GroupDocs.Conversion trong các dự án ASP.NET để xử lý tài liệu phía máy chủ.

Cân nhắc về hiệu suất

Việc tối ưu hóa hiệu suất của GroupDocs.Conversion bao gồm:

  • Quản lý tài nguyên hiệu quả: Xử lý Converter các đối tượng kịp thời để giải phóng tài nguyên.
  • Chuyển đổi có chọn lọc: Chỉ chuyển đổi những trang hoặc phần tài liệu cần thiết để giảm thời gian tải. Việc thực hiện các biện pháp quản lý bộ nhớ .NET tốt nhất sẽ đảm bảo ứng dụng của bạn luôn phản hồi nhanh và hiệu quả.

Phần kết luận

Trong suốt hướng dẫn này, bạn đã học cách thiết lập GroupDocs.Conversion cho .NET, tải tệp OTG và áp dụng các chuyển đổi thực tế. Các bước tiếp theo, hãy cân nhắc khám phá các tùy chọn chuyển đổi bổ sung và tích hợp GroupDocs.Conversion với các thành phần khác trong hệ thống của bạn.

Để tự mình thử triển khai giải pháp, hãy truy cập Tài liệu GroupDocs để khám phá các tính năng nâng cao.

Phần Câu hỏi thường gặp

  1. Tệp OTG là gì?
    • Tệp Mẫu đồ họa OpenDocument (OTG) là định dạng được sử dụng để tạo đồ họa vector và sơ đồ trong bộ ứng dụng văn phòng nguồn mở.
  2. Tôi có thể sử dụng GroupDocs.Conversion cho các loại tài liệu khác không?
    • Có, GroupDocs.Conversion hỗ trợ nhiều định dạng tài liệu bao gồm Word, Excel, PDF, hình ảnh, v.v.
  3. Làm thế nào để xử lý các tệp OTG lớn một cách hiệu quả?
    • Sử dụng các tính năng chuyển đổi có chọn lọc để chỉ xử lý những phần cần thiết trong tài liệu của bạn.
  4. Có hỗ trợ cài đặt chuyển đổi tùy chỉnh không?
    • Đúng vậy, GroupDocs.Conversion cho phép cấu hình chi tiết các tùy chọn chuyển đổi.
  5. Tôi phải làm gì nếu ứng dụng của tôi báo lỗi đường dẫn tệp?
    • Xác minh đường dẫn đã chỉ định là chính xác và có thể truy cập được bằng cách kiểm tra quyền và cấu trúc thư mục.

Tài nguyên

Để đọc thêm và tìm thêm tài liệu: